Boy band TWS sells 200,000 copies of album 'Sparking Blue' on debut day
SEOUL -- TWS, the brother band of boy group Seventeen, has sold more than 200,000 copies of its album "Sparking Blue" on its debut day. The debut album has also topped iTunes song charts in Thailand and India. According to album sales data released by South Korea's Hanteo Chart, 206,240 copies of Sparking Blue were sold on January 22. The new album entered the iTunes song charts in 11 countries including Britain, Japan, the Netherlands, and Italy as of January 22.

Exports of kimchi reaches $155.6 mln in 2023, up 10.5% year-on-year
SEOUL -- Exports of kimchi, traditional Korean pickled vegetables, soared 10.5 percent year-on-year to $155.6 million in 2023, state data showed. The increased popularity of kimchi is accelerated thanks to the high global recognition of the salad-like spicy mixed vegetable pickles as healthy food.
